public static void Main()
int height = int.Parse(Console.ReadLine());
string lens = new string('/', 2 * height - 2);
string bridge = new string('|', height);
string emptySpace = new string(' ', height);
string lensAndFrame = string.Format("{0}{1}{0}", '*', lens);
string frame = new string('*', 2 * height);
for (int i = 0; i < height; i++)
if (i == 0 || i == height - 1)
Console.WriteLine("{0}{1}{0}", frame, emptySpace);
else if (i == (height - 1) / 2)
Console.WriteLine("{0}{1}{0}", lensAndFrame, bridge);
Console.WriteLine("{0}{1}{0}", lensAndFrame, emptySpace);